New Zealand - Re-Export of Knitted or Crocheted Men's and Boys' Underpants or Briefs of Cotton

Since 2014, New Zealand Re-Export of Knitted or Crocheted Men's and Boys' Underpants or Briefs of Cotton fell by 23.4%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 8 comparing other countries in Re-Export of Knitted or Crocheted Men's and Boys' Underpants or Briefs of Cotton at $280,925.25. New Zealand is overtaken by Cyprus, which was ranked number 7 at $305,165.76 and is followed by Saudi Arabia at $237,695.69. United Arab Emirates lead the ranking with $14,391,897.4 in 2019, a decrease of 13.4% compared to 2018. United States, Canada and Ethiopia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Armenia witnessed the best average annual growth at +350.3% per year, while Belize was the worst growing country at -50.8% per year.
